We are searching for a Project Engineer to provide onsite support for Project Managers, Superintendents, and Field Personnel by leading the day-to-day coordination, documentation, tracking, and communication for a Building and Engineering firm. The salary range for this position is $90k to $115k, depending on education and experience.
Responsibilities
- Lead daily coordination between project management, field teams, and subcontractors.
- Manage and track project documentation including RFIs, submittals, and change orders.
- Support project scheduling efforts and monitor progress against timelines.
- Assist in cost tracking, budgeting, and forecasting activities.
- Serve as a communication hub between stakeholders to ensure project alignment.
- Ensure compliance with contract documents, drawings, and specifications.
- Coordinate procurement of materials, equipment, and subcontractors.
- Maintain accurate project records and reporting systems.
- Participate in project meetings and provide updates on progress and risks.
- Assist with field inspections and quality control processes.
- Identify and escalate project risks, delays, and issues.
- Support safety compliance and enforcement of jobsite standards.
- Collaborate with engineering teams to resolve design conflicts.
- Assist with project closeout including punch lists and documentation.
- Drive continuous improvement in project execution and coordination practices.
